Heads up, maintainers: the TimeWeave solver won't return anything useful unless you authenticate against our internal constraints service first. Every solve request gets checked there before the scheduler at Brindlemoor Academy sees it, so skipping auth just gets you a 401 and a sad log line. Pass the key in the usual request header on every call. The key you want is right here.

API key for kajog-tajep: zpat11_KM2XGfcA8zM

Finance Review Summary — Closure of the Pellbrook Office

Prepared for the incoming director. The Pellbrook satellite office, opened four years ago to support the Harwick contract, no longer covers its operating costs following that contract's wind-down. Lease termination fees, severance, and relocation of three staff to the Denmoor site total an estimated one quarter of annual savings. Closure is targeted for end of fiscal year. The confidential note on how this fits the broader business plan follows below.

management briefing: Istaelix Group is in early talks to buy Sorysax Logistics for about $496.2 million. The Kasox launch date is October 3, and nothing goes to the press before then. Legal wants the Norokax Foods term sheet withdrawn before April 25.

# StockTally Environments

StockTally's inventory reconciliation job runs nightly in production and hourly in staging, comparing warehouse counts against the ledger. Support should note that staging uses synthetic data, so mismatches there are expected and not ticket-worthy. Production mismatches above the threshold trigger a hold on affected SKUs. Each environment runs the reconciliation job with the following configuration.

config for kafof-bawef:
holath:
  log_level: debug
  metrics_host: metrics.holath.qorvelsys.internal
  pin: 2191
  pool_size: 32

## Who owns this thing?

Welcome aboard! The batch digest scheduler (aka "Drumbeat") is the service that decides when Quillside users get their summary emails. It's mostly a cron wrapper plus a queue, but the timezone bucketing logic is hairy — don't touch `bucketizer.py` without a review. Deploys go out Tuesdays. If a digest run fails, re-run with the `--window` flag rather than resending everything, or you'll double-mail people. For anything you're unsure about, your first stop is the maintainer listed right below.

named custodian: Brivan Eliath Quenox Frador